TonyTitan Posted April 30, 2013 Share Posted April 30, 2013 Sounds like your browsers may have some sort of script blocker enabled that is preventing the green button from activating. So....download manually, then at the top left column under the Mods Tab of NMM, select "Import Mod from File", and let NMM do it's thing. The benefit to you being that you will gain your simple uninstalls again.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
thiagosods Posted November 29, 2013 Share Posted November 29, 2013 Go to your NMM and run as administrator than click in settings, General, and under the associations mark the option "Associate with NXM URLs" it worked for me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

MisterSeethan Posted March 11, 2014 Share Posted March 11, 2014 Go on NMM. Click on settings (gears in the upper left hand corner) go to the "Download Options" tab. It will say "Use multithreaded downloads, which is a premium feature. Uncheck it. This should work unless you have premium.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
